Re: Best time to visit US west coast for kitesurfing

Summer is your best bet

Start in long beach, Belmont shores

Then, Nicholas canyon,

Ventura

Waddell creek

San Fran, then hop over to Sherman island, Sherman is great for camping and kiting

Then you gotta do hood river. You are done. Make it 2 weeks minimum.
